Guilford, Pennsylvania had a population of 2,923 in 2020. It was 84.0% White, 2.9% Black, 2.7% Asian, 6.6% Hispanic, 0.3% Native American/Other, and 3.4% Multiracial. This map presents the population of Guilford, with one dot drawn for each person counted in the 2020 Census, color-coded by race.

Of the 1,888 places in Pennsylvania, Guilford is the 477th most populous.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s).
